What Are LLM-Powered Healthcare Chatbots?

LLM-powered healthcare chatbots are conversational AI systems built on advanced language models capable of understanding and generating human-like responses. Instead of following fixed scripts, they interpret patient intent and provide relevant, conversational answers.

Healthcare providers commonly use these chatbots to:
-Schedule and manage appointments
-Answer frequently asked questions
-Send medication reminders
-Share post-treatment instructions
-Guide patients through insurance queries
-Support symptom screening
-Assist with patient onboarding

These chatbots enhance communication while keeping healthcare professionals involved whenever medical judgment is required.

How Do LLM-Powered Healthcare Chatbots Work?

Successful Healthcare AI chatbot development combines several technologies into a secure workflow.

Natural Language Understanding (NLU) helps the chatbot interpret everyday patient questions.

Large Language Models (LLMs) generate meaningful, context-aware responses instead of keyword-based replies.

Knowledge Base Integration connects the chatbot with trusted medical resources or internal documentation, improving answer quality.

Human Escalation ensures complex or emergency cases are transferred to qualified healthcare professionals.

This combination creates a better experience for both patients and healthcare staff.

Real-World Use Cases

### 1. Appointment Scheduling

Patients can book, cancel, or reschedule appointments in seconds without calling the clinic.

2. Virtual Patient Support

Healthcare chatbots answer common questions about hospital services, operating hours, prescriptions, and insurance coverage.

3. Medication Reminders

Automated reminders improve treatment adherence for patients managing chronic conditions.

4. Symptom Assessment

AI chatbots collect symptoms before appointments and guide patients toward the appropriate department. They do not replace medical diagnosis but help streamline the intake process.

5. Post-Discharge Follow-Up

Hospitals use chatbots to send recovery instructions, monitor patient progress, and remind patients about follow-up visits.

Real-World Examples

Several healthcare organizations have successfully adopted conversational AI.

Mayo Clinic has introduced AI-powered patient support tools that help users find reliable health information and navigate care more efficiently.

Babylon Health became one of the most recognized examples of AI-assisted healthcare by providing virtual consultations and symptom assessment to millions of users across multiple countries.

These examples demonstrate how AI can improve accessibility and operational efficiency when supported by appropriate clinical oversight.

Market Trends and Industry Data

Healthcare AI adoption continues to accelerate worldwide.

According to McKinsey & Company, generative AI could create $60–110 billion in annual value for healthcare by improving productivity and operational efficiency.

Grand View Research projects strong growth in the healthcare chatbot market as organizations continue investing in digital patient engagement.
The World Health Organization (WHO) also encourages responsible AI implementation that prioritizes transparency, patient safety, and human oversight.

These findings highlight why conversational AI is becoming an important investment for healthcare providers.
